Air Fryer Mummy Dogs with Bacon

Hot dogs are wrapped in pre-cooked bacon and crescent roll dough and then cooked in the air fryer.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Course Main Dish Recipes
Servings 8
Calories 312 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 can Pillsbury crescent dough sheet
  • 1 package 8 count Nathan's hot dogs
  • Wilton candy eyes
  • 8 strips cooked bacon

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the air fryer to 350-375 degrees. Use the temperature listed on the cooking directions on the crescent dough package.
  • Roll out the sheet of crescent roll dough on a parchment-lined cookie sheet.
  • Cut the dough into strips.
  • Roll a slice of bacon around each hot dog.
  • Wrap a strip of dough around the hot dog and then another strip around the hot dog in a diagonal direction.
  • Spray the air fryer tray with cooking spray and lay each hot dog on the tray.
  • Cook for 10 minutes, allowing enough time for the bacon to get crisp and the dough to cook properly.
  • When hot dogs are cooked, leave them to cool off in the air fryer or remove them from the air fryer and place them on a rack to cool a bit.
  • Add two candy eyes to each hot dog, carefully tucking them under and around the crescent roll dough.
